ECS-2520S25-240-FN-TR,2520有源晶振,ECS贴片晶振,型号:ECS-2520S系列晶振,编码为:ECS-2520S25-240-FN-TR,频率:24MHz,尺寸:2.5*2.0mm,工作温度为:﹣40°C ~ 85°C,微型ECS-2520S是微型SMD HCMOS紧密稳定石英晶体振荡器,2.5 x 2.0 x 0.9毫米陶瓷封装是理想之选 对于稳定性至关重要无线和IOT应用。

ECS-2520S25-240-FN-TR,2520有源晶振,ECS贴片晶振,型号:ECS-2520S系列晶振,编码为:ECS-2520S25-240-FN-TR,频率:24MHz,尺寸:2.5*2.0mm,工作温度为:﹣40°C ~ 85°C,微型ECS-2520S是微型SMD HCMOS紧密稳定石英晶体振荡器,2.5 x 2.0 x 0.9毫米陶瓷封装是理想之选 对于稳定性至关重要无线和IOT应用。
| PARAMETERS | CONDITIONS | ECS-2520S | UNITS | ||||||||||||||
| MIN | TYP | MAX | |||||||||||||||
| Frequency Range | 
					 | 
				
					 | 
				24 | 
					 | 
				MHz | ||||||||||||
| Frequency Stability * | EN (-40 ~ +85°C) | ± 15 | ppm | ||||||||||||||
| FN (-40 ~ +85°C) | ± 10 | ppm | |||||||||||||||
| Power Supply | Vdd ±10% | +1.8, +2.5, +3.0, +3.3 | V DC | ||||||||||||||
| Current Consumption | 7 | mA | |||||||||||||||
| Standby Current | 10 | µA | |||||||||||||||
| Output | HCMOS | 15 | pF | ||||||||||||||
| Output voltage Level | VOL:10%Vdd max./VOH:90%Vddmin.V DC | ||||||||||||||||
| Rise & Fall time | 10%Vdd – 90%Vdd | 5 | ns | ||||||||||||||
| Duty Cycle | @ ½ Vdd | 45/55 | % | ||||||||||||||
| Phase Noise | @ 10 KHz offset | -145 | dBc/Hz | ||||||||||||||
| Operating Temp | -40 | +85 | °C | ||||||||||||||
| Storage Temp | -55 | +125 | °C | ||||||||||||||
